Każdy kto zajmuje się pisaniem kodu wie jak pracochłonne jest to zajęcie. Największe trudności sprawia odnalezienie się wśród setek czy tysięcy linijek, efektywne nawigowanie i praca z edytorem tekstu. Aby nieco ułatwić to zadanie programy te zawierają coraz więcej przydatnych funkcji. Jednak każdy z nas ma inne wymagania i czego innego oczekuje od programu, z którym będzie na co dzień pracował.

No dobrze, ale jaki edytor wybrać skoro mamy tak ogromny wybór?

iMac_LEFTsz317

Jak wynika z innego artykułu na naszym blogu warto wybrać Sublime Text.

Każdy wie jak istotny jest komfort pracy. Osobiście nie spotkałem lepszego edytora tekstu.

Jeżeli chcesz poznać niesamowite możliwości edytora Sublime Text zobacz nasz najnowszy kurs Efektywna praca w Sublime Text

Zawsze przed zakupem (tak, jest płatny) warto przetestować dany program. Twórcy Sublime Text dają nam możliwość pobrania darmowej 30 dniowej pełnej wersji.

Zapytacie pewnie co jest takiego w tym programie?

Otóż ma on bardzo intuicyjny i przejrzysty interfejs – wystarczy poświęcić tylko chwilę, aby się z nim zaznajomić i tym samym znacząco przyspieszyć naszą pracę.

iMac

Na pierwszy rzut oka Sublime wydaje się pozbawiony niemal wszelkich funkcji. Zostały one jednak zręcznie ukryte, aby w żaden sposób nie rozpraszać nas podczas pracy.

Jest niezwykle lekki i nie obciąża nawet starszych komputerów.

Bardzo ciekawym rozwiązaniem jest zminimalizowana wersja pisanego przez nas kodu (mini mapa) znajdująca się po prawej stronie programu. Dzięki temu możemy błyskawicznie przejść do danej części kodu bez niepotrzebnego błądzenia i szukania, jak to często ma miejsce przy długich programach.

Bardzo przydatne są skróty również klawiszowe, które niemal całkowicie eliminują potrzebę korzystania z myszki dzięki rozbudowanemu systemowi nawigowania.

Znajdziemy tu tak popularne skróty jak: wytnij, cofnij, itp., ale także te mniej znane a równie przydatne jak:

Ctrl + L – zaznacza cały wiersz

Ctrl + D – zaznacza słowo (przy kolejnych kliknięciach automatycznie zaznacza identyczne słowa w innych miejscach dzięki czemu możemy zmienić dowolną ilość wyrazów jednocześnie.st2-logo

Przykład: Pomyliłeś się i zamiast „<<” w całym kodzie zastosowałeś „>>”. Teraz możesz albo przez kilkanaście minut poprawiać wszystko ręcznie, albo użyć kombinacji Ctrl + D i poprawić cały kod za jednym zamachem!

Ctrl + KK – usuwa wszystko od kursora do końca linii

Ctrl + K + ⌫ (Backspace)– usuwa wszystko od kursora do początku linii

Ctrl + Shift + D – powiela dany wiersz

Ctrl + Home – przenosi na początek dokumentu

Ctrl + End – przenosi na koniec dokumentu

Ctrl + H– pozwala zamienić dane słowo na inne

Ctrl + N– tworzy nowy plik

Alt+Shift+1– dzieli dostępną przestrzeń na jedną kolumnęBez-nazwy-1

Alt+Shift+2– dzieli dostępną przestrzeń na dwie kolumny

Alt+Shift+3– dzieli dostępną przestrzeń na trzy kolumny

Alt+Shift+4– dzieli dostępną przestrzeń na cztery kolumny

Alt+Shift+5– dzieli dostępną przestrzeń na cztery części (dwie na górze i dwie na dole)

Ctrl + P– wyświetla listę otwartych plików (przydatne przy dużej ich ilości)

Więcej przydatnych skrótów znajdziesz na stronie:

a także w naszym kursie

Dowiedz się więcej: Efektywna praca w Sublime Text Zobacz kurs

Podsumowanie

Z czystym sumieniem mogę polecić Wam ten program. Zakochałem się w nim od pierwszego kliknięcia i już nie wyobrażam sobie pracy z innym edytorem tekstu.

A w jakim programie Wy piszecie? Znacie jakieś równie dobre, a jednocześnie darmowe alternatywy dla Sublime Text?